Interview includes the following on closed containment: 

Westcoaster.ca: The Pacific Salmon forum recently released some recommendations on open-net pen salmon farms. One of those suggestions was that the provincial government design and implement a commercial-scale trial of a closed containment system. 

Premier Gordon Campbell: We think that that’s actually a good idea. We’re working in partnership with the federal government on that. We may be able to find a way that that partnership will work so that we can have a closed contained system where we can see whether it’s economically viable . . .
